    More than just Sushi

    Would recommend this place for those who want more than just sushi. Black cod was excellent. Duck was good, but a little fatty. The sauces are flavorful and dishes are presented nicely. Sushi is pretty standard - just your basic rolls. If you like "Designer" rolls don't come here. Beware, drinks are tiny. I ordered a Jack and Coke that came in what looked like a 4 oz glass. Of course at $11 it was the same price as most standard sized drinks.

    Good overall, service is sketchy

    Oh, what a difference going at prime time makes! We went for dinner last Friday night, and while it's not packed since it's summer, our waiter was rushed and didn't give us enough attention. I ordered my salmon rare, and it came back well done. May as well be a different dish altogether! The other experience I had there was fantastic, went on a Sunday night and ordered sushi a feast for the eyes and palette. Yum! So I will return ... just not on a weekend night!
